Output 3946a6bf3bcbbf61c263fe563bac6dbe56599e332c6bd7ec7c9851ee623b0e32:11

value
631267262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39747fde50bc14a93852a5bdfae52e13b91e65a1 OP_EQUAL
address
36vp11CfE7wXgJZ8hVnAqorahUcNTQpWhE
transaction
3946a6bf3bcbbf61c263fe563bac6dbe56599e332c6bd7ec7c9851ee623b0e32
confirmations
232530
spent
true